assemblee-virtuelle / archipelago

Fostering interconnections between communities by creating synergies between their platforms
Apache License 2.0
14 stars 6 forks source link

Réécrire les urls pour les rendre user-friendly #146

Open mguihal opened 8 months ago

mguihal commented 8 months ago

Tension Actuellement les urls des ressources sont difficilement lisibles (exemple pour une organisation : https://archipel.assemblee-virtuelle.org/Organization/https%3A%2F%2Fdata.virtual-assembly.org%2Forganizations%2Fassemblee_virtuelle/show)

Ce type d'url a plusieurs inconvénients :

Proposition Le but est de réécrire les urls de type https://archipel.assemblee-virtuelle.org/Organization/https%3A%2F%2Fdata.virtual-assembly.org%2Forganizations%2Fassemblee_virtuelle/show vers https://archipel.assemblee-virtuelle.org/organization/assemblee_virtuelle/show

Le mécanisme a apparemment déjà été effectué sur un autre site utilisant Semapps : Oasis (voir https://github.com/assemblee-virtuelle/semapps/issues/636)

srosset81 commented 8 months ago

Il faudra prendre en compte qu'on peut aussi lier des resources qui sont externes, et à ce moment il faudra avoir un URL complet.

Pour Destination Oasis, il y avait pas ce problème car toutes les données proviennent du même backend. Mais Archipelago a des fonctionnalités d'import.